• Garrison Brewing has released a special beer, almost a year in the making: they aged their Grand Baltic Porter in rum barrels from Ironworks Distillery in Lunenburg, NS for ten months. This is a very limited brew, with only 417 bottles available. This beer weighs in at 11% ABV, definitely picking up some tasty rum from the barrel (their regular Grand Baltic Porter is 9%). Tracy Phillipi of Garrison was kind enough to provide us with tasting notes: “With aromas of cherries & caramel, this ruby-brown specialty brew is balanced by flavor notes of coffee, smoke & leather. Not for the faint of heart, Barrel Aged Grand Baltic Porter leaves a dry warming sensation on your palate”. This beer is only available at the brewery, so pop down soon to grab a bottle.
